«reactjs» etiketlenmiş sorular

React (React.js veya ReactJS olarak da bilinir), Facebook tarafından kullanıcı arabirimleri oluşturmak için geliştirilmiş bir JavaScript kitaplığıdır. Açıklayıcı, bileşen tabanlı bir paradigma kullanır ve hem verimli hem de esnek olmayı hedefler.

5
Eşlenecek nesneler dizisi olmadan React.js'de öğeler nasıl döngülenir ve oluşturulur?
Bir jQuery bileşenini React.js'ye dönüştürmeye çalışıyorum ve zorluk yaşadığım şeylerden biri, for döngüsüne dayalı n sayıda öğeyi oluşturmaktır. Bunun mümkün olmadığını veya tavsiye edilmediğini ve modelde bir dizi bulunduğunda kullanılmasının tamamen mantıklı olduğunu anlıyorum map. Sorun değil, ama bir diziniz olmadığında ne olacak? Bunun yerine, işlenecek belirli sayıda öğeye eşit …

11
Typescript input onchange event.target.value
Benim tepki ve daktilo uygulamasında, ben kullanın: onChange={(e) => data.motto = (e.target as any).value}. Sınıf için yazımları nasıl doğru bir şekilde tanımlarım, böylelikle yazım sisteminde yolumu kesmek zorunda kalmazdım any? export interface InputProps extends React.HTMLProps<Input> { ... } export class Input extends React.Component<InputProps, {}> { } Eğer koyarsam target: { …


3
Bileşen yerine getDerivedStateFromProps yaşam döngüsü yöntemi nasıl kullanılır?
componentWillReceivePropsYeni bir yaşam döngüsü yöntemi lehine gelecek sürümlerde tamamen aşamalı olarak kaldırılacak gibi görünüyor getDerivedStateFromProps: static getDerivedStateFromProps () . İnceleme sonucunda, artık this.propsve arasında nextPropsolduğu gibi doğrudan bir karşılaştırma yapamayacağınız anlaşılıyor componentWillReceiveProps. Bunun etrafında bir yol var mı? Ayrıca, şimdi bir nesne döndürür. Dönüş değerinin temelde olduğunu varsaymak doğru this.setStatemudur? …

11
React.js: Bir onChange işleyicisiyle farklı girişleri tanımlama
Buna yaklaşmanın doğru yolunun ne olduğunu merak ediyorum: var Hello = React.createClass({ getInitialState: function() { return {total: 0, input1:0, input2:0}; }, render: function() { return ( <div>{this.state.total}<br/> <input type="text" value={this.state.input1} onChange={this.handleChange} /> <input type="text" value={this.state.input2} onChange={this.handleChange} /> </div> ); }, handleChange: function(e){ this.setState({ ??? : e.target.value}); t = this.state.input1 + …
142 javascript  reactjs  jsx 

9
Değişmez İhlal: “Bağlan” (“Connect (SportsDatabase)” bağlamında ya da desteklerinde "mağaza" bulunamadı
Tam kodu burada: https://gist.github.com/js08/0ec3d70dfda76d7e9fb4 Selam, Oluşturma ortamı temelinde masaüstü ve mobil cihazlar için farklı şablonlar gösteren bir uygulamam var. Mobil şablonum için gezinme menüsünü gizlemem gereken yerde başarıyla geliştirebiliyorum. şu anda tüm değerleri prototiplerden aldığı ve doğru bir şekilde oluşturduğu bir test senaryosu yazabiliyorum ancak mobil olduğunda nav bileşenini oluşturmaması …
142 reactjs  mocha  redux 

2
JSX.Element, ReactNode vs ReactElement ne zaman kullanılır?
Şu anda bir React uygulamasını TypeScript'e geçiriyorum. Şimdiye kadar, bu oldukça iyi çalışıyor, ancak renderişlevlerimin ve işlev bileşenlerimin dönüş türleriyle ilgili bir sorunum var . Şimdiye kadar, hep kullanmıştı JSX.Elementbir bileşen karar verirse şimdi bu artık çalışmıyor, dönüş türü olarak değil bir şey, yani geri dönüşü hale nullberi nullhiçbir geçerli …

10
Sanal DOM nedir?
Son zamanlarda Facebook'un React çerçevesine baktım . Gerçekten anlamadığım "Sanal DOM" kavramını kullanıyor. Sanal DOM nedir? Avantajları nelerdir?

6
Webpack dosya yükleyici ile görüntü dosyaları nasıl yüklenir
Ben kullanıyorum WebPack bir yönetme reactjs projeyi. Javascript webpack tarafından görüntüleri yüklemek istiyorum file-loader. Aşağıda ise webpack.config.js : const webpack = require('webpack'); const path = require('path'); const NpmInstallPlugin = require('npm-install-webpack-plugin'); const PATHS = { react: path.join(__dirname, 'node_modules/react/dist/react.min.js'), app: path.join(__dirname, 'src'), build: path.join(__dirname, './dist') }; module.exports = { entry: { jsx: …

6
ReactJS çağrı üst yöntemi
ReactJS'de ilk adımımı atıyorum ve ebeveyn ile çocuklar arasındaki iletişimi anlamaya çalışıyorum. Form yapıyorum, bu yüzden alanları şekillendirmek için bileşenim var. Ayrıca alan ve kontrol içeren üst bileşen var. Misal: var LoginField = React.createClass({ render: function() { return ( <MyField icon="user_icon" placeholder="Nickname" /> ); }, check: function () { console.log …

4
React, durum güncellemelerinin sırasını tutuyor mu?
React'in performans optimizasyonu için zaman uyumsuz ve toplu olarak durum güncellemelerini gerçekleştirebileceğini biliyorum. Bu nedenle, aradıktan sonra güncellenecek duruma asla güvenemezsiniz setState. Ama Tepkisiz güvenebilirsiniz aynı sırada devlet güncellemek setStatedenir için aynı bileşen? farklı bileşenler? Aşağıdaki örneklerde düğmeyi tıklamayı düşünün: 1. ihtimali hiç var mı sahte ve b doğrudur için: …

15
React with Typescript'te ref nasıl kullanılır
React ile Typescript kullanıyorum. Referanslar tarafından atıfta bulunulan reaksiyon düğümlerine göre statik yazım ve zeka elde etmek için ref'leri nasıl kullanacağımı anlamakta güçlük çekiyorum. Kodum aşağıdaki gibidir. import * as React from 'react'; interface AppState { count: number; } interface AppProps { steps: number; } interface AppRefs { stepInput: HTMLInputElement; …

12
TypeScript ve React - çocuklar yazıyor mu?
Aşağıdaki gibi çok basit bir işlevsel bileşene sahibim: import * as React from 'react'; export interface AuxProps { children: React.ReactNode } const aux = (props: AuxProps) => props.children; export default aux; Ve başka bir bileşen: import * as React from "react"; export interface LayoutProps { children: React.ReactNode } const layout …

8
Eşzamansız componentDidMount () kullanmak iyi mi?
componentDidMount()React Native'de zaman uyumsuz işlev olarak kullanmak iyi bir uygulama mı yoksa bundan kaçınmalı mıyım? AsyncStorageBileşen bağlandığında biraz bilgi almam gerekiyor , ancak bunu mümkün componentDidMount()kılmanın tek yolu işlevi eşzamansız hale getirmek . async componentDidMount() { let auth = await this.getAuth(); if (auth) this.checkAuth(auth); } Bununla ilgili herhangi bir sorun …

8
Django ve ReactJS'nin birlikte çalışması nasıl sağlanır?
Django için yeni ve hatta ReactJS için daha yeni. AngularJS ve ReactJS'yi araştırdım, ancak ReactJS'ye karar verdim. AngularJS'nin pazar payından daha fazlasına sahip olmasına rağmen AngularJS'yi popülerlik kadar sınırlandırdığı görülüyordu ve ReactJS'nin alımdan daha hızlı olduğu söyleniyor. Tüm bu önemsiz bir yana, Udemy üzerine bir ders almaya başladım ve birkaç …
138 django  reactjs 

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.